I bought my banshee with these flatslide carbs. if i leave my banshee for a while it will leak fuel out of the lower left vent tube. if i turn off the gas im fine. when i start it it will run fine. it will then die. when i do get it running i will fire one cylinder for a minute or two while under wot. after i burn the gas out it runs fine and i dont have a problem. could it be that my float is set too low. i think that my float is allowing the bike to choke but when warm it kills. any other ideas?

Posted

If you are getting fuel coming out the vent tube the float is probably stuck open or the needle valve is not sealling and it's overfilling the bowl. Just pull the bowl off and have a look.
